The ciliates are a group of protozoans characterized by the presence of hair-like organelles called cilia, which are identical in structure to eukaryotic flagella, but are in general shorter and present in much larger numbers, with a different undulating pattern than flagella. The defining characteristics of Phylum Ciliophora is that the organisms in this phylum use cilia to move around. They are heterotrophic and usually consume bacteria. An example of an organism that is classified under Phylum Ciliophora is Paramecium caudatum. Image of a Paramecium caudatum.
